Transaction e8ebcef8ba08d9bfd52c1251cb21bfb858c389cac16484cd91a2db4f19b09314
1 Input
1 Output
-
e8ebcef8ba08d9bfd52c1251cb21bfb858c389cac16484cd91a2db4f19b09314:0
- value
- 505047
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86fd76f85d23572578801d06d38a16308cb59358 OP_EQUAL
- address
- 3Dzn7Hbnm8J7uV4diMnduP5YstcQ65VD2K